How much do legal operations assistant j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for legal operations assistant in Wisconsin is $48,666.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$38,400.00 and $55,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a legal operations ass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Legal Operations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of legal processes, often supported by a degree in legal studies or related field. Familiarity with legal document management systems, billing software, and Microsoft Office Suite is typically required, along with experience using e-billing platforms or contract management tools.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to manage multiple priorities make someone stand out in this role. These skills ensure efficient legal department operations, compliance, and effective support for attorneys and clients.

What is a legal operations assistant?

Legal Operations Assistants support legal departments or law firms by handling administrative tasks, managing documents, and streamlining processes to improve efficiency. They often assist with budgeting, technology solutions, vendor management, and compliance tracking. By taking on these operational responsibilities, they enable lawyers and legal teams to focus more on legal work rather than administrative duties. Legal Operations Assistants play a key role in ensuring that the legal department runs smoothly and cost-effectively.

How does a legal operations assistant typically collaborate with other departments within a law firm or legal department?

A Legal Operations Assistant frequently works cross-functionally by coordinating with attorneys, paralegals, finance, IT, and HR teams to streamline legal processes and improve efficiency. This role often assists with contract management, legal billing, and technology implementation, requiring clear communication and teamwork. Developing strong relationships with these departments not only helps ensure smooth workflows but also provides valuable exposure to different facets of the organization, offering opportunities for professional growth.

Job Description:

Legal Practice Assistant

Drive Operational Excellence

At Ashurst Perkins Coie US LLP, our people are our greatest asset. We're looking for a collaborative, detail-oriented Legal Practice Assistant to join our team and help deliver an exceptional employee experience.

In this role, the Legal Practice Assistant provides high-level, complex administrative support to first-year associates with minimal supervision as a key member of the Legal Practice Assistant (LPAC) team. This role also partners with local offices and practice groups to strengthen collaboration, develop solutions, and bridge support gaps. As a representative of Perkins Coie, the LPA upholds the firm's reputation by demonstrating professionalism, discretion, and the highest standards of confidentiality.

What You'll Do

  • Serve as a trusted partner, mentor, and primary point of contact for assigned first-year associates.
  • Collaborate with local offices and practice groups to streamline workflows, close support gaps, and deliver effective solutions.
  • Anticipate needs by proactively managing attorney workloads, priorities, and deadlines from start to finish.
  • Draft, edit, proofread, and finalize complex legal documents with exceptional accuracy.
  • Manage calendars, travel, meetings, and court deadlines to keep attorneys organized and prepared.
  • Coordinate court and agency filings, ensuring compliance with all procedural and filing requirements.
  • Handle client communications, calls, correspondence, and mail with professionalism, discretion, and urgency.
  • Partner with docketing, conflicts, accounting, and other business teams to support seamless legal operations.
  • Prepare expense reports, reimbursements, trust documents, notebooks, and other administrative materials.
  • Organize meetings, conference logistics, and client events while maintaining electronic and physical files.
  • Conduct legal and internet research and support special projects as assigned.
  • Accurately maintain time entry and leverage firm technology, including ServiceNow, to manage workflow and productivity.
  • Demonstrate reliability, accountability, and flexibility through consistent attendance, clear communication, and effective time management.
  • Uphold the highest standards of professionalism, integrity, and client confidentiality in every interaction.

What You'll Bring

  • Requires a high school diploma or equivalent.
  • Previous law firm experience of seven or more years preferred.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Type a minimum of 75 WPM with exceptional accuracy.
  • Experience with patent prosecution and trademark law.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including grammar, punctuation, and professional correspondence.
  • Strong organizational, prioritization, and time-management skills with the ability to thrive in a fast-paced, evolving environment.
  • Proficient with Microsoft Office, document management systems, and standard office technology; comfortable using Webex and collaboration tools.
  • Solid knowledge of legal terminology, records management, and document retrieval practices.
  • Working knowledge of state and federal court rules, administrative procedures, filing requirements, and deadlines.
  • Demonstrated technical aptitude with strong analytical and creative problem-solving skills.
  • Self-motivated, adaptable, and collaborative, with the ability to build effective relationships across offices and practice groups.
  • Experience supporting Perkins Coie First-Year Associates and a strong understanding of the firm's resources, workflows, and support model.
  • Proven ability to mentor associates, anticipate needs, identify solutions, and bridge operational support gaps while delivering exceptional client service.
